Cause or Necessary action
The adjustment data is abnormal. Cycle the
power. If it still occurs, contact the seller
(NF Corporation or our agent) from whom
you purchased the product.
The power input voltage is excessive. Check
if the power input is appropriate.
The power input voltage is insufficient.
Check if the power input is appropriate.
There is a communication error between the
firmware and the power unit. Cycle the
power. If it still occurs, contact the seller
(NF Corporation or our agent) from whom
you purchased the product.
There is a communication error between the
firmware and the output measurement
section. Cycle the power. If it still occurs,
contact the seller (NF Corporation or our
agent) from whom you purchased the
product.
All power unit versions do not match.
A power unit of unsupported version is
connected.
A multi-phase model is connected with
system cable. Use the multi-phase model as
a single unit.
There is no power unit that can be started.
The output voltage is excessive. This may
occur at an abrupt change in the output
current due to the inductive load.
Also when the remote sensing function set
to FB, check the feedback cable connects
correctly. (See 8.2.2)
The output current RMS value is excessive
on a module in the power unit. This may
occur when the output terminal is
short-circuited.
Also when the remote sensing function set
to FB, check the feedback cable connects
correctly. (See 8.2.2)
The output current peak value is excessive.
The DC power supply in the power unit is
abnormal, or see the notes in "9.1.3,
Operation procedure."
